How they compare
Namibia currently reports 162,719 An against 130,969 An in Lesotho, a difference of 31,750 An.
That makes Namibia's figure about 1.2 times Lesotho's.
The two have swapped places 12 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Namibia ahead.
Lesotho ranks 39th and Namibia ranks 38th of 133 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Lesotho averaged higher in 4 and Namibia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Lesotho | Namibia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 51,939 An | 58,253 An | 6,314 An | Namibia |
| 1970s | 94,102 An | 66,240 An | 27,862 An | Lesotho |
| 1980s | 121,719 An | 72,900 An | 48,819 An | Lesotho |
| 1990s | 153,880 An | 110,078 An | 43,801 An | Lesotho |
| 2000s | 152,942 An | 149,420 An | 3,521 An | Lesotho |
| 2010s | 119,026 An | 156,483 An | 37,456 An | Namibia |
| 2020s | 131,008 An | 162,365 An | 31,356 An | Namibia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
